Privacy Act; STATE-81, Office of Foreign Missions Records
Document Number: 2016-12621
Type: Rule
Date: 2016-05-27
Agency: Department of State
The Department of State is issuing a final rule to amend its Privacy Act regulation exempting portions of a system of records from one or more provisions of the Privacy Act of 1974.
Culturally Significant Objects Imported for Exhibition Determinations: “Garden, Art, and Commerce in Chinese Woodblock Prints” Exhibition
Document Number: 2016-12620
Type: Notice
Date: 2016-05-27
Agency: Department of State
Notice is hereby given of the following determinations: Pursuant to the authority vested in me by the Act of October 19, 1965 (79 Stat. 985; 22 U.S.C. 2459), E.O. 12047 of March 27, 1978, the Foreign Affairs Reform and Restructuring Act of 1998 (112 Stat. 2681, et seq.; 22 U.S.C. 6501 note, et seq.), Delegation of Authority No. 234 of October 1, 1999, Delegation of Authority No. 236-3 of August 28, 2000 (and, as appropriate, Delegation of Authority No. 257 of April 15, 2003), I hereby determine that the objects to be included in the exhibition ``Garden, Art, and Commerce in Chinese Woodblock Prints,'' imported from abroad for temporary exhibition within the United States, are of cultural significance. The objects are imported pursuant to a loan agreement with the foreign owners or custodians. I also determine that the exhibition or display of the exhibit objects at The Huntington Library, Art Collections, and Botanical Gardens, San Marino, California, from on or about September 17, 2016, until on or about January 9, 2017, and at possible additional exhibitions or venues yet to be determined, is in the national interest. I have ordered that Public Notice of these Determinations be published in the Federal Register.
Department of State Acquisition Regulation; Technical Amendments; Correction
Document Number: 2016-12355
Type: Rule
Date: 2016-05-27
Agency: Department of State
The Department of State published in the Federal Register of April 27, 2016 a rule amending the Department of State Acquisition Regulation (DOSAR) to make non-substantive corrections and editorial changes. It mistakenly added a section heading as a subpart heading. This document corrects that error.
